Steve Mccurry
Steve McCurry was born on February 24, 1950 in Pennsylvania, attended Penn State
University. Steve McCurry (born
February 24, 1950) is an American
photojournalist best known for his
photograph, "Afghan Girl" that originally
appeared in National Geographic magazine.

Michael Kenna
Michael Kenna (born 1953) is an English photographer best
known for his black & white landscapes. He
has received the following awards:
Honorary Master of Arts (Brooks Institute,
Santa Barbara, California, USA,
2003),Chevalier of the Order of Arts and
Letters (Ministry of Culture, France,
2000),Golden Saffron Award, (Consuegra,
Spain, 1996), and many.

Mario Testino
Mario Testino (was born on October 30, 1954) is a Peruvian
fashion photographer. His work has been
featured in magazines such as Vogue and Vanity Fair. One of
fashion's most sought-after snappers.

Annie Leibovitz
Arguably the most famous portrait
photographer working today, Leibovitz has
photographed many of the world’s major
celebrities, often in elaborate and
imaginative set-ups.When Leibovitz
returned to the United States in 1970, she
started her career as staff photographer, working for the just
launched Rolling Stone magazine.
